Manor Lords: How to Protect Your Berry Patches Like a Pro!

Discussion in the post mainly focused on the usefulness of creating pastures near berry patches to prevent deforestation, and Lavitz questioned whether this method is still effective today. The majority of the community responded positively. eatU4myT added that while the pasture strategy works, a more attractive option exists: designating specific zones for timber and firewood cutting. This way, players can protect their berry patches while maintaining a bit more order in their forestry activities. It’s a thoughtful approach that combines practicality with aesthetic appeal for your medieval kingdom.

Mastering Manor Lords: How to Get Rid of Those Pesky Trees Ruining Your View

Initial replies to OddsGods’ inquiry were primarily from players excited to offer their strategies for dealing with unwanted vegetation. Notably, matth3976 suggested building a path to eradicate individual trees as they pass through. It appears that paths are a versatile solution not only for navigational challenges but also for various logistical problems. This tip was beneficial to several players, as it enabled them to maintain their well-designed settlements while clearing their sightlines without excessive demolition.

Essential Valorant Tips: Level Up Your Game with User-Approved Advice

One key piece of advice that stood out was emphasizing the importance of adjusting sensitivity in gameplay, particularly for precise aiming. Many users found that Huge_Ninja4068’s settings might have been too high, making it challenging to make fine adjustments. This issue with high sensitivity seemed to be a recurring topic in the comments. For instance, yot_gun mentioned, “it seems like your sensitivity is set too high, making it difficult for you to make precise adjustments.” This observation highlighted a common challenge faced by players who primarily use wrist movements. Although finding the right sensitivity can sometimes be a matter of personal preference, the general consensus was that reducing sensitivity slightly could improve control during battles. Moreover, several users recommended switching to a claw grip to enhance aim control. BananaDaPowerful, for example, suggested this change to minimize the risk of sweaty palms interfering with crucial moments in the game. This adjustment could also offer a more comfortable gaming experience during extended matches.

Why Does Everything Seem So Huge in Valorant? Exploring Map Design Differences

Upon revisiting Valorant after playing CS:GO, veterans of the game quickly notice distinct changes. As CTS99 pointed out, the map layout, particularly in terms of corridors and entry points, seems almost endless compared to CS:GO. Moreover, players have commented on the contrasting gameplay rhythm. For example, one user observed, “The movement speed is quicker in CS:GO, making it feel more compact.” Indeed, CS:GO players seem to move swiftly like sprinters in an Olympic event, while Valorant characters appear slightly slower, akin to navigating through a bustling mall during the holiday season. This pace difference influences how players perceive space, suggesting that although maps may have the same dimensions, their perceived size can vary significantly based on movement dynamics.
